I'm running 7000 watts in my jeep. I got a 270a Mechman Ho alt / 75ah car audio batt in the from and two 75 ah batts in the back with 4 runs off 0 gauge knu cca ( 2 pos and 2 neg ) I'm fusing the amps ( 2 sundown 3000ds ) I'm wondering if there is is a need to fuse after the the batts up front because from what I know the wires will never see 500 amps of current ( its a daily driver ). But I might be wrong so that's where you guys who know better chime in. I'm thinking I don't need to fuse the the wires near the front but I could be wrong

 
are you talking about from front to rear?

If so, yes..

Fuse front pos and rear pos.. that protects both batteries should something happen to the power cable or the batteries

a knu fuse holder is $25 shipped.. worth it imo to be safe..

There is no technical explanation.. its just a safety precaution. Hell you could run your entire system without fuses anywhere if you really wanted to

Just cause you arent pulling 500 amps thru that wire doesnt mean it doesnt need a fuse..you're charging batteries with the cable.. fuse it

its mainly used incase of a wire getting cut and shorting, it keeps the batts from deadshorting and burning up the wire, which could burn the car down.
yup.

or exploding batteries.. doesnt sound fun
